Position Summary

We are seeking a compassionate and motivated Certified Occupational Therapy Assistant (COTA) to join our rehabilitation team on a PRN basis.

Working under the supervision of a licensed Occupational Therapist, you will provide skilled therapy services designed to help residents improve function, increase independence, and enhance their quality of life.
Key Responsibilities


* Provide occupational therapy treatments as directed by the supervising Occupational Therapist


* Follow physician orders and individualized treatment plans


* Document daily treatments, weekly progress notes, and resident outcomes accurately and timely


* Monitor resident progress and communicate updates to the Occupational Therapist


* Assist nursing staff with training and implementation of restorative programs


* Participate in interdisciplinary care planning, rehabilitation meetings, and discharge planning activities


* Educate residents, families, and caregivers on maintenance programs and discharge recommendations


* Assist with cleaning and maintenance of therapy equipment and treatment areas


* Report equipment concerns and assist in maintaining a safe therapy environment


* Participate in staff education and in-service training programs


* Ensure compliance with facility policies, state regulations, and payer requirements


* Maintain positive and professional relationships with residents, families, staff, and healthcare providers
